@charset "iso-8859-2";

body {color: #535353; font-size: 12px;}

#line_top { background-color:#262D3D; height:5px; margin:auto; width:100%;}
#naglowek { background-color: #FFFFFF; margin:auto; width:100%; background-image:url(../imgs/ss24_naglowek.png); background-position:center;}
#head{ margin:auto; width:980px; height:100px; border-bottom: #AFB2B7 solid 1px;}

#stopka {	background-color: #E4E4E2; margin:auto; width:100%; height: 120px; clear:both; }
#stopka_kontener{ margin:auto; width:980px; height:120px; }
#stopka_kontener .kontenerLewy { width:200px; text-align:center; float:left; color: #262D3D; font-family:'Tahoma'; font-size:11px; font-weight:bold; }
#stopka_kontener .kontenerLewy a { color: #787878; font-size:10px; font-weight:normal; text-decoration:none; margin-top:6px; }
#stopka_kontener .kontenerLewy a:hover { color: #262D3D;}
#stopka_kontener .kontenerPrawy{ width:780px; text-align:center;  float:left; }
#stopka_kontener .kontenerPrawy li{ font-family: 'Tahoma'; font-size: 11px; list-style: none;font-weight:normal; }
#stopka_kontener .kontenerPrawy a { color: #787878; font-size:11px; font-weight:normal; text-decoration:none; }

#stopka #menu 	{ list-style: none;width: 980px; font-size: 10px; font-weight: bold; color: #605A50; margin:auto; margin-top: 6px; text-align: center; }
#stopka #menu li { list-style: none; display: inline; padding: 5px; cursor:pointer;  cursor:hand; margin-right: 10px; }
#copyright { font-family: 'Tahoma'; color: #B0B0B0; font-size:10px; float:right; margin-right:10px; margin-top:20px; clear:both;}

#menu_top
	{
		list-style: none;

		width: 980px;

		font-size: 10px;
		color: #FFFFFF;
		margin:auto;

		text-align: right;
	}
	
#menu_top li
	{
		list-style: none;
		display: inline;
		padding: 5px;

		cursor:pointer; 
		cursor:hand;
		color: #fff;
		margin-right: 10px;
	}
	
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color:#E4E4E2;
	font-family:Arial, Helvetica, sans-serif;	
}
img {border:0;}


#naglowek_menu {
	background-color: #262D3D;
	height:30px;
	margin:auto;
	width:100%;
	padding-top:10px;  background:url(../imgs/naglowek.gif)
}

#naglowek_logo {
	background-color: #FFFFFF;
	margin:auto;
	width:980px;
	height:80px;
	border-bottom: #DEE2E5 solid 1px;
}

.szukaj {border: #262D3D solid 1px; color: #262D3D; font-size: 12px; height:16px;}

#cialo { width:100%; display: table; border-bottom: #E5E5E5 solid 1px; background-color:#FFFFFF; }
#kontener { margin:auto; width:980px; }

#apart 	.scroll {
		position:relative;
		overflow:hidden;
		width: 500px;
		height: 200px;
		float:left;
	}
	
/*
#navi { font-size: 11px; padding-top: 3px;}
#navi a { font-size: 10px; font-weight:bold; color: #262D3D; text-decoration:none;}
#navi a:hover { color: #D10000;}
*/
#kontener_1 {
	margin-top:20px;
	margin-right:10px;
	float:left;
	width:220px;
	
}

#kontener_2 {
	margin-top:20px;
	float:left;
	width:750px;
}

#partnerzy {
	margin:auto;
	width:980px;
	border-top: #FFF solid 1px;
	height:60px;
	color:#BCBCBC;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
}

#aktualnosci { 	margin:auto; width:980px; border-top: #FFF solid 1px; border-bottom: #E7E7E7 solid 1px; padding-top: 10px; 	height:140px; color:#828289; font-size:12px; overflow: hidden; }
#aktualnosci td { color:#828289; font-size:11px; }



#apart #nazwa {	font-size: 20px;}
#apart #zakladki { padding:8px; overflow:hidden;height:223px; border-top: #CF2C1E solid 2px; border-bottom: #DEE2E5 solid 1px; border-left: #DEE2E5 solid 1px; border-right: #DEE2E5 solid 1px;}
#zajawka { float:left; width: 215px; height: 200px; background-color:#F8F8F8; border: #DEE2E5 solid 1px; font-size:12px; }
#parametry { font-size:12px; margin-top:10px; margin-bottom:10px;height:75px;}
#nadrzedny {text-align: center; font-size:14px; margin-top:10px; height:60px;}
#ceny { text-align:center; font-size:12px;}
#info #foto { float:left; width: 510px;}
#info #zajawka { float:left; width: 215px; height: 200px; background-color:#F8F8F8; border: #DEE2E5 solid 1px; font-size:12px; }
 .link {font-size:11px; color:#747474; text-decoration:none; }
 .link:hover {color:#d10000;}
#info #ceny { text-align:center; font-size:12px;}
#info #nadrzedny {text-align: center; font-size:14px; margin-top:10px; height:60px;}
#info #parametry { font-size:12px; margin-top:10px; margin-bottom:10px;height:75px;}

#apart #opis {margin-top: 10px; padding: 8px; color: #535353; font-size: 12px; text-align:justify;}
.opis {margin-top: 5px; padding: 8px; color: #535353; font-size: 12px; text-align:justify;}
/*#apart #navi { font-size: 11px; clear:both;}
#apart #navi a {border: 1px solid #dfe0e3; text-align: center; margin: 0 2px 0 0; color:#000000; text-decoration: none; font-size: 10px; padding: 2px 6px 2px 6px;}
*/
/*#apart .zakladki_menu { background:url(http://cuadro/noctis/imgs/tmp_navi_off.gif); width: 79px; height: 31px; text-align: center; color:#000; font-size: 12px; cursor:pointer; cursor: hand;}
*/

/*#apartamenty {  padding: 8px; background-color:#F2F2F2; border-top: #CF2C1E solid 2px; border-bottom: #DEE2E5 solid 1px; border-left: #DEE2E5 solid 1px; border-right: #DEE2E5 solid 1px;}
#apartamenty .zajawka { width: 100%; height: 110px; border-top: #DEE2E5 solid 1px; color: #000000; font-size: 14px; }
#apartamenty .zajawka:first-child { width: 100%; height: 110px; border-top: #DEE2E5 none 1px; color: #000000; font-size: 14px; }
*/

#apartamenty { padding: 8px;  border-top: #d10000 solid 2px; border-bottom: #d10000 solid 2px;}
#apartamenty .zajawka { width: 100%; height: 95px; padding-top:5px; border-top: #DEE2E5 solid 1px; color: #000000; font-size: 14px; }
#apartamenty .zajawka:first-child { width: 100%; height: 95px; border-top: #DEE2E5 none 1px; color: #000000; font-size: 14px; }

#naskroty { padding: 8px;  border-top: #d10000 solid 2px; border-bottom: #d10000 solid 2px;}
#naskroty .zajawka { width: 100%; height: 105px; border-top: #AFB2B7 solid 1px; color: #000000; font-size: 12px; padding-top:5px; }
#naskroty .zajawka:first-child {  border-top: #DEE2E5 none 1px;color: #000000; }

#box { border: #C6C6C6 solid 1px; padding-top: 4px; width: 200px; }
#box #naglowek {padding-top:7px; border: #262D3D solid 1px; width: 192px; height:25px; background:url(../imgs/box_naglowek_n.gif); color:#FFFFFF; font-size: 13px; font-weight: bold;}
#box #opis {padding-top:7px; font-size: 13px; }

/*#box a { margin-top: 4px; color:#000000; text-decoration: none; font-size: 13px; padding-left: 10px; display: block; height: 2px;}*/


#box-r { border: #C6C6C6 solid 1px; padding-top: 4px; width: 200px; float: right; margin-left:20px;}
#box-r #naglowek {padding-top:7px; border: #D10000 solid 1px; width: 192px; height:22px; background:url(../imgs/box_naglowek_r.gif); color:#FFFFFF; font-size: 12px; font-weight: bold;}
#box-r a { margin-top: 4px; color:#000000; text-decoration: none; font-size: 13px; padding-left: 10px; display: block; height: 2px;}



.navi { width:300px; height:20px;  }
.navi a { background-color: #ffffff; border: #DFE0E3 solid 1px; width:18px; height:16px; float:left; margin-right:2px; margin-top:3px; display:block; font-size:11px; color:#000000; 	text-align:center; padding-top:2px; cursor:pointer; }

/* mouseover state */
.navi a:hover {
	background-position:0 -8px;      
}

/* active state (current page state) */
.navi a.active { background-color:#D10000; color:#FFFFFF; }


#box-wyszukaj { border-top: #C6C6C6 solid 1px; border-left: #C6C6C6 solid 1px; border-right: #C6C6C6 solid 1px; padding-top: 4px; width: 200px; background-color: #F7F7F7; }
#box-wyszukaj #naglowek {padding-top:7px; border: #D10000 solid 1px; width: 192px; height:25px; background:url(../imgs/box_naglowek_r.gif); color:#FFFFFF; font-size: 13px; font-weight: bold;}
#box-wyszukaj select { width:170px;padding:2px;margin-left:9px; margin-top: 2px; font-size:11px; }
#box-wyszukaj a { margin-top: 4px; color:#000000; text-decoration: none; font-size: 13px; padding-left: 10px; display: block; height: 2px;}
#box-wyszukaj .tresc{ font-size:11px; padding: 6px 4px 12px 6px; font-weight:bold; border-bottom: #C6C6C6 solid 1px; background-image:url(../imgs/ss24_podcien.gif); background-position:bottom; background-repeat:repeat-x;}
#box-wyszukaj-infolinia { width:250px; margin-bottom:6px;}
#box-wyszukaj-info { float:left; width: 700px; height:83px; padding-left:8px; margin-bottom:8px; float:left; font-size:11px; text-align:justify;}
#box-wyszukaj-naglowek { border: #C6C6C6 solid 1px; border-bottom:#f7f7f7 solid 1px; padding-top:6px; width:250px; height:25px; background-color:#F7F7F7;color:#000000; text-align:center;font-weight:bold;}

#box-wyszukaj-start { border: #C6C6C6 solid 1px; padding-top: 8px; width:390px; height:235px; background-color:#F7F7F7;float:left;; color:#000000; overflow:hidden; background-image:url(../imgs/ss24_podcien.gif); background-position:bottom; background-repeat:repeat-x;}
#box-wyszukaj-start .tresc{ font-size:12px; padding: 6px 4px 12px 6px; font-weight:bold; border-bottom: #C6C6C6 solid 1px;}
#box-wyszukaj-start .naglowek {margin-left: 8px; padding-top:6px; border: #D10000 solid 1px; width: 292px; height:22px; background:url(../imgs/box_naglowek_r.gif); color:#FFFFFF; font-size: 13px; font-weight: bold;}
#box-wyszukaj-start select { width:130px;padding:3px;margin-left:9px; margin-top: 2px; font-size:11px; }

#box-wyszukaj-start2 { border: #C6C6C6 solid 1px; padding-top: 4px; width:200px; height:335px; background-color:#F7F7F7;float:left;; color:#000000; overflow:hidden; background-image:url(../imgs/ss24_podcien.gif); background-position:bottom; background-repeat:repeat-x;}
#box-wyszukaj-start2 select { width:160px;padding:2px;margin-left:16px; margin-top: 2px; font-size:11px; }

#box-wyszukaj-start2 #naglowek {padding-top:6px; border: #D10000 solid 1px; width: 192px; height:22px; background:url(../imgs/box_naglowek_r.gif); color:#FFFFFF; font-size: 13px; font-weight: bold; margin-bottom:6px;}

#baner {  margin-top:10px; float:right; width:362px;}
#znajdziesz_nas {width:100px; height:20px; background:url(../imgs/ss24_znajdziesz_nas_n.png); float:right; margin-right:40px;}
#startowe-najpopularniejsze {  margin-top:10px; float:left; width:370px; padding-left:6px; padding-top:8px;}

/*#startowe-miejscowosci {  margin-top:10px; float:left; width:980px;}*/
#startowe-miejscowosci {  margin-top:-10px; float:left; width:960px; background-color:#AFB2B7; padding:10px;}

#startowe-ostatnie {  margin-top:10px; float:left; width:206px; padding-left:6px; padding-top:8px; padding-bottom:8px; border-right: #AFB2B7 1px solid; border-left: #AFB2B7 1px solid;}
	/* main vertical scroll */
	#main {
		position:relative;
		overflow:hidden;
		height: 850px;
	}
	
	/* root element for pages */
	#pages {
		position:absolute;
		height:20000em;
	}
	
	/* single page */
	.page {
		padding:10px;
		height: 1550px;
		width:540px;
		/*background-color:#F7F7F7;*/
	}
	
	/* root element for horizontal scrollables */
	.scrollable {
		position:relative;
		overflow:hidden;
		width: 530px;
		height: 850px;
	}
	
	/* root element for scrollable items */
	.scrollable .items {
		width:20000em;
		position:absolute;
		clear:both;
	}
	
	/* single scrollable item */
	.item {
		float:left;
		cursor:pointer;
		width:500px;
		height:850px;
		padding:10px;
	}
	
	/* main navigator */
	#main_navi {
		float:left;
		padding:0px !important;
		margin:0px !important;
	}
	
	#main_navi li {
		background-color:#fff;
		border-bottom:1px solid #AFB2B7;
		clear:both;
		color:#000;
		font-size:12px;
		height:100x;
		list-style-type:none;
		text-align:center;
		padding:10px;
		width:190px;
		cursor:pointer;
	}
	

	
	#main_navi li.active {
		background-color:#F7F7F7;
	}
	
	#main_navi img {
		float:left;
		margin-right:10px;
	}
	
	#main_navi strong {
		display:block;
	}
	
	#main div.navi {
		margin-left:250px;
		cursor:pointer;
	}

#menu_box { border-right:#AFB2B7 solid 1px;  margin-right:30px; height:500px; text-align:right; }
/*background-image:url(../imgs/ss24_podklad_m.gif); background-position:right; background-repeat:repeat-y;*/
#menu_box a {font-size: 12px; text-decoration:none; color:#7E7E7E;margin-top:3px; display:block; border-left:1px none #999999;border-bottom:1px none #999999; border-top:1px none #999999; border-right:1px solid #ffffff; padding-right:10px; position:relative; left:2px; padding-top:2px; padding-bottom:3px;padding-left:3px;}
#menu_box .active {font-size: 12px; text-decoration:none; color:#7E7E7E;margin-top:3px; display:block; border-left:1px solid #999999;border-bottom:1px solid #999999; border-top:1px solid #999999; border-right:1px solid #ffffff; padding-right:10px; position:relative; left:2px; background-color:#FFFFFF; padding-top:2px; padding-bottom:3px;padding-left:3px;}
#menu_box a:hover {color:#d10000;}


#rezerwacja2 { padding:8px; overflow:hidden;height:260px; border-top: #CF2C1E solid 2px; border-bottom: #DEE2E5 solid 1px; border-left: #DEE2E5 solid 1px; border-right: #DEE2E5 solid 1px;}
.podsumowanie { float:left; width:280px; font-size:13px; font-weight:bold; color:#262D3D; margin-top: 4px; padding-bottom: 6px; margin-bottom: 6px}


#miejscowosc .scroll { position:relative; overflow:hidden; width:730px; height:200px; float:left;}
#miejscowosc #opis {margin-top: 10px; padding: 8px; color: #535353; font-size: 12px; text-align:justify;}
#miejscowosc #zakladki { padding:8px; overflow:hidden;height:223px; border-top: #d10000 solid 2px; border-bottom: #DEE2E5 solid 1px; border-left: #DEE2E5 solid 1px; border-right: #DEE2E5 solid 1px;}
 .zakladki_menu { background:url(../imgs/tmp_navi_off.gif); width: 79px; height: 31px; text-align: center; color:#000; font-size: 12px; cursor:pointer; cursor: hand;}

#obiekt_nazwa {	font-size: 20px;}

.scroll2 { position:relative; overflow:hidden; width: 460px; height: 260px; float:left; color:#262D3D; font-size:12px;}
.scroll2 .pics { width:20000em; position:absolute; clear:both; }

.scroll2 .pics div { float:left;cursor:pointer; width:480px !important;	height:220px; margin:0px; }
	
.scroll2 input {font-size:12px;border:1px solid #CFD1D4; color: #262D3D;} 
.scroll2 textarea {font-size:12px;border:1px solid #CFD1D4; color: #262D3D; overflow:hidden;} 	
.scroll2 .naglowek {font-size:13px; font-weight:bold; display:block; margin-bottom:4px;}


.startowe { position:relative; overflow:hidden; width: 588px; height: 245px; float:left; color:#262D3D; font-size:12px;}
.startowe .pics { width:20000em; position:absolute; clear:both; }

.startowe .pics div { float:left;cursor:pointer; width:670px !important;	height:280px; margin:0px; }
#status {
	margin:0px !important;
	height:35px;
	background:#123 url(../imgs/ss24_podklad_r.gif) repeat-x;
/*	border-left: 1px solid #DEE2E5; border-right: 1px solid #DEE2E5;
color:#A9A9A9;*/
	_background:#123;
	overflow: hidden;
}

#status li {
	list-style-type:none;
	list-style-image:none;
	margin-left:-60px !important;
	/*margin-right:30px !important;*/
	float:left;
	color:#A9A9A9;
	font-size:13px;
	padding:10px 20px;
	width: 197px;
}

#krok_1.active { background-image:url(../imgs/ss24_podklad_r_2.gif); background-repeat:no-repeat;}
#krok_2.active { background:url(../imgs/ss24_podklad_r_2.gif) no-repeat; }
#krok_3.active { background:url(../imgs/ss24_podklad_r_2.gif) no-repeat; }
#krok_4.active { background:url(../imgs/ss24_podklad_r_4.gif) no-repeat; }
#status li.active {
	/*background-color:#d10000;*/
	font-weight:normal;		
	color: #fff;
}



#drawer {
	background:#d10000 ;
	_background-color:#d10000;
	overflow:visible;
	color:#ffffff;
	font-weight: bold;	
	position:fixed;	
	left:0;
	top:0;
	text-align:center;
	padding:5px;
	font-size:16px;
	border-bottom:2px solid #d10000;
	width:100%;
	height:18px;
	display:none;
	z-index:2;
}

.scroll2 .error {
	border:1px solid #d10000;		
}

.dane {font-weight:bold; height:19px; font-size:12px; }

#nawigacja { font-size:11px; text-decoration:none; height:20px; }
#nawigacja a { color:#646466; text-decoration:none;}

#zrealizowane {font-size:13px; margin-top:30px; float:left; color:#262D3D; margin-left: 20px;}
#box-wyszukaj-start2 .opiss { font-size:11px; padding-left:7px; font-weight:bold; color:#000000;}



#regulamin ul {list-style-type:lower-alpha; }
